Generalized color codes supporting non-Abelian anyons
Abstract
We propose a generalization of the color codes based on finite groups G . For non-Abelian groups, the resulting model supports non-Abelian anyonic quasiparticles and topological order. We examine the properties of these models such as their relationship to Kitaev quantum double models, quasiparticle spectrum, and boundary structure.
